Variables Affecting Prices
A number of essential elements influence roof installation prices that you ought to take into consideration as you intend your job.
Initially, the kind of roof covering material plays a substantial function. Asphalt tiles are usually much more affordable, while products like slate or metal can drive costs up.
Your roofing system's size and pitch likewise impact rates; bigger or steeper roofing systems need more materials and labor, enhancing the total expense.
Labor expenses can vary depending upon your place and the specialist's experience. It's important to obtain numerous quotes to guarantee you're getting a fair cost.
Additionally, if your roofing system has existing concerns, like structural damages or mold and mildew, these will require to be resolved prior to setup, including in your prices.
Seasonality matters also. Roof covering tasks are typically less costly in the off-peak months, while need throughout optimal season can pump up prices.
Lastly, regional licenses and policies may need charges, so it's good to check what's required in your area.
Budgeting for Your Roofing System Project
Budgeting for your roof covering task is vital to avoid unanticipated expenses and financial pressure. Beginning by evaluating your requirements; take into consideration the type of products you want, the dimension of your roofing system, and any type of added att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. Study the average costs in your location to obtain a reasonable concept of what to expect.
Once you have a fundamental quote, include a buffer-- generally around 10-15% for unexpected problems such as surprise damages or enhanced material expenses.
Do not fail to remember to consider labor expenses, which can differ dramatically depending upon the intricacy of your roofing and the service provider you choose.
Next, take into consideration any permits or examination fees. It's important to make up these upfront to stay clear of shocks later on.
If you're funding the job, check out lending options or layaway plan that match your spending plan. Set a clear timeline and stick to it to stop prices from escalating.
Finally, monitor all expenses and receipts throughout the procedure. This will certainly aid you remain arranged and make changes as needed.
